Runbook: Shrinkray CLI — account recovery. If the batch resize service account gets locked (usually after too many bad token swaps from the Quillford mirror), don't panic. Revoke the stale tokens first, then re-init the agent with `shrinkray auth reset`. It'll churn for a minute, that's normal. When it asks for the recovery credentials, paste the service recovery passphrase exactly as stored, which is the following:

strongbox words: novwyn-julvan-weniel-jorax-sorix-pelath-druwyn-druok-soreth

Tide-table widget (Moonwrack SDK): plugins must request the tidal dataset via the provider API, never bundle static tables — stations drift and we re-survey quarterly. Cache responses for at most six hours. If the widget renders blank, check that your manifest declares the coastal-data capability. Breaking schema changes are announced two releases ahead. Supported station formats and the deprecation calendar are listed on the page below.

wiki page, tahaf-tajog: https://jira.ordindyn.corp/pipeline

## Environments: dependency pinning

All Marrowline environments pin dependencies to exact versions; no ranges permitted. Staging may trial updated pins for one sprint before production promotion. Unpinned transitive dependencies fail the build gate. Exceptions require sign-off from the platform lead. Pin enforcement in each environment is governed by the following configuration values:

settings of kagup-tagug:
ULAIX_HOST=ulaix.zemvarsys.internal
ULAIX_PORT=8000

### Large-file diffs

The Granite diff viewer streams hunks for files over 20MB instead of loading them whole. Release builds should verify the `/diff/stream` endpoint returns chunked responses with stable hunk IDs across retries. Rendering falls back to byte-range mode for binaries. All requests to the diff service require internal service authentication, using the key that follows.

service key, fawip-bajef: kto11_Qt5wZK9vdNC